Thracian Chersonese. Chersonesos circa 386-338 BC.
Hemidrachm AR
12,5mm., 2,13g.
Forepart of a lion to right, his head turned back to left / Quadripartite incuse square with two raised and two sunken squares, in one of the sunken squares, pellet and A monogram, in the other, bucranium (bull's head).
good very fine
McClean 4091 var. (ΑΓ monogram on reverse).
